Maps of Meaning: The Architecture of Belief is a 1999 book by Canadian clinical psychologist and psychology professor Jordan Peterson. The book describes a theory for how people construct meaning, in a way that is compatible with the modern scientific understanding of how the brain functions. [1] It examines the "structure of systems of belief.

In 1999, Routledge published Peterson's Maps of Meaning: The Architecture of Belief. The book, which took Peterson 13 years to complete, describes a comprehensive theory for how we construct meaning, represented by the mythical process of the exploratory hero, and provides an interpretation of religious and mythical models of reality presented.

Maps of Meaning Summary Science and Myth. To begin, Peterson establishes that mythological and scientific thinking aren't meant to achieve the same goals. Human experience is both objective and subjective—science is essential for understanding objective reality, but myth determines the subjective value of the world around us.
